bitter rot

noun

Definition of bitter rot

1 : a very destructive disease of apples, grapes, and other fruit caused by a fungus (Glomerella cingulata) and producing cankers on the twigs, limbs, and fruit spurs and a spotting or blistering and decay of the fruit characterized by bitterness of the pulp

called also anthracnose, ripe rot

2 : a rot of ripening grapes caused by an imperfect fungus (Melanconium fuligineum)
